Please explain floating roots.

Answer:

The roots of some plants such as mangroves remain suspended in air. These roots are known as floating roots or suspended roots. The roots of mangroves have difficulty in breathing in saline soil. Hence, the project above the level of water and store air. They also make the plant light and support plant growth.
